On Jan. 7 the Bristol City Council approved two rezoning ordinances, approved consent agenda resolutions including cyber and transit items, passed a tax-equivalent payment resolution and appointed Dr. Barry Hopper to the library board; roll-call votes were recorded for each motion.

The Bristol, Tennessee City Council recorded multiple formal votes at its Jan. 7 meeting. The council approved two rezoning ordinances, adopted the consent agenda (which included several resolutions), separately approved a tax-equivalent payment resolution and appointed Dr. Barry Hopper to the library board. All recorded votes were affirmative as read by the city clerk during the meeting.

Ordinance 24-16 (rezoning to R-3 for properties on Glen/Glendale Street) had a public hearing earlier in the meeting; the council approved the ordinance on second reading by roll call.
